Team Tanzania Jets off to UK

The Tanzania Cricket Team left for UK today to play 6 build up games as their final preparations for the ICC World Cricket League Division 4 to be hosted in Bologna, Italy from the 14th – 21st August 2010.

Five of their six games in UK have been organized by The Watford Town Cricket Club who have been associated with the Tanzania Cricket Association for the last 2 years.  The Tanzania Cricket Association highly appreciates the strong support from the Watford Town Cricket Club for the development of the game in Tanzania.

All the 5 games will be played at the Watford Town Cricket Club as follows:

Regional Invitation X1 or Combined Services v Tanzania                     2nd August

Club Cricket Conference v Tanzania                                                 3rd August

Hertfordshire v Tanzania                                                                  4th August

Sussex 2  v Tanzania                                                                      5th August

MCC v Tanzania                                                                              6th August

The Cricket Week has been programmed and well publicized amongst the Watford Local community and we expect to have an eventful week.

The sixth and the last game will be played at Leicester against the Countesthrope Cricket Club at their club ground on the 8th of August.

Left arm leg spinner and top order batsmen Athmani Kakonzi will unfortunately miss out on this event, as he has recently undergone a Hernia surgery. However, this opens the doors for a 19-year old left arm leg spinner Harsh Ramaiya, who is eagerly waiting to exploit this situation and cement his place in the senior team.

These build up games in UK will assist the Tanzanian players in gaining experience and adopt themselves with the European conditions.
